MI 161-7 (19 Ovs) vs RCB | SCORECARD

Mumbai Indians suffered another setback in the death overs as Raj Bawa was dismissed after a fighting cameo.

Josh Hazlewood returned to the attack and immediately tightened the screws with a sharp yorker and disciplined lines. Bawa managed a couple of runs through smart placement but struggled to find timing under pressure.

A worrying moment followed when a slower bouncer struck Bawa on the helmet, leading to a mandatory concussion check. Play resumed, but soon after, Bawa mistimed a shot and was caught by Rajat Patidar, who held on safely to a sharp chance.

Corbin Bosch then came to the crease and got off the mark with a single, but MI continued to lose momentum at a crucial stage.

After 19 overs, MI stood at 161 for 7, with Hazlewood striking at a key moment to keep Royal Challengers Bengaluru firmly on top heading into the final over.
